i reckon you should machine a groove for the
O-ring that is on the stock dizzy, or else you'll get an oil leak.Best to do it now while everything is still apart than to run the engine & get oil all over it. You should be able to get an O ring from a Nissan dealer or maybe even the local parts place can get it in for you.
